The Enduring Story of Andrew
The name Andrew, as a matter of fact, comes from a very old language, specifically Greek. It has its roots in the word Ἀνδρέας, which, you know, itself is related to the ancient Greek term 'aner.' This particular Greek word, 'aner,' simply means 'man.' So, it's almost like the name itself is a declaration of human qualities, isn't it? Because of this origin, the name Andrew has long been associated with qualities like being strong and having a manly spirit. It's a given name that you find in a lot of different countries, making it a truly global sort of identifier. How Does Andrew's Past Shape Its Present?
The earliest significant mention of Andrew, from what we know, comes from ancient religious texts, where he appears as a key figure in a pivotal story. He was, actually, one of the very first people called by Jesus to follow him, and he was also the first to openly declare that Jesus was the Messiah. This early role, you see, seems incredibly important, placing him right at the beginning of a profound movement. Yet, despite this seemingly central position as an early follower, Andrew often remains a bit of a background character in many accounts. We get one fairly big look at who Andrew was early on in the Gospel of John, but beyond that, he pretty much stays out of the spotlight, even though he was one of the chosen twelve. It’s quite curious, isn’t it, how someone so instrumental can also be somewhat less known?
This quiet dedication, however, is a defining aspect of his story. Even after Jesus’s death, tradition tells us that Andrew just kept on bringing people to Christ. He never seemed to care about putting his own fame or recognition first. This characteristic of persistent, humble service is a powerful part of his legacy. Beyond the Gospels - Andrew's Lasting Influence
The influence of Andrew stretches far beyond the pages of ancient texts, you know, touching various aspects of culture and society even today. For example, he is revered as the patron saint of both Scotland and Russia, which is a pretty significant honor in itself. This kind of widespread recognition speaks to the enduring respect and admiration people have held for him throughout history. His feast day, which falls on November 30th, is a time when many communities remember his life and his contributions. It's a quiet way that his legacy continues to be acknowledged and celebrated, even after centuries have passed.
